+.TH io_uring_prep_read 3 "November 15, 2021" "liburing-2.1" "liburing Manual"
+.SH NAME
+io_uring_prep_read \- prepare I/O read request
+.SH SYNOPSIS
+.nf
+.B #include <liburing.h>
+.PP
+.BI "void io_uring_prep_read(struct io_uring_sqe *" sqe ","
+.BI " int " fd ","
+.BI " void *" buf ","
+.BI " unsigned " nbytes ","
+.BI " __u64 " offset ");"
+.fi
+.SH DESCRIPTION
+.PP
+The
+.BR io_uring_prep_read (3)
+prepares an IO read request. The submission queue entry
+.I sqe
+is setup to use the file descriptor
+.I fd
+to start reading
+.I nbytes
+into the buffer
+.I buf
+at the specified
+.IR offset .
+
+On files that support seeking, if the offset is set to
+.BR -1 ,
+the read operation commences at the file offset, and the file offset is
+incremented by the number of bytes read. See
+.BR read (2)
+for more details. Note that for an async API, reading and updating the
+current file offset may result in unpredictable behavior, unless access
+to the file is serialized. It is not encouraged to use this feature, if it's
+possible to provide the desired IO offset from the application or library.
+
+On files that are not capable of seeking, the offset is ignored.
+
+After the read has been prepared it can be submitted with one of the submit
+functions.
+
+.SH RETURN VALUE
+None
+.SH ERRORS
+The CQE
+.I res
+field will contain the result of the operation. See the related man page for
+details on possible values. Note that where synchronous system calls will return
+.B -1
+on failure and set
+.I errno
+to the actual error value, io_uring never uses
+.IR errno .
+Instead it returns the negated
+.I errno
+directly in the CQE
+.I res
+field.
